Identification of He3 in the binary system 68u Herculis
Description
From a radial velocity study of 60 spectrograms of the binary system 68u Herculis, systematic velocity differences have been found to exist between the He I singlet lines and the He I triplet lines of the primary component. These differences are independent of orbital phase, date of observation of spectrograph employed and can be interpreted in terms of the existence of a large fraction of He3 in the atmosphere of the primary component. |$\text{A}\,\text{He}^{3}/\text{He}^{4}$| ratio of between 4 : 1 and 49 : 1 is suggested.
